Step 1:Back Up Your Data clone hard drive to ssd free

Back Up Your Data Before you start the cloning process, it is essential to back up all your data. Make sure to copy all your files, documents, and important data to an external hard drive or cloud storage. This is necessary in case of any accidental data loss during the cloning process.

Step 2:Choose Your Cloning Software

Choose Your Cloning Software To clone your hard drive to an SSD, you need cloning software. There are various free cloning software available online, such as EaseUS Todo Backup, Clonezilla, Macrium Reflect, and more. Choose one that suits your needs and download it to your computer.

Step 3:Connect Your clone hard drive to ssd

Connect Your SSD Connect your SSD to your computer using a SATA cable or USB cable. If your SSD is a new one, you might need to initialize and format it first. Follow the instructions provided with your SSD to do this.

Step 4:selected the correct drives. clone hard drive to ssd free

Run the Cloning Software Open the cloning software on your computer and select the option to clone your hard drive to an SSD. Choose the source hard drive, which is the one you want to clone, and select the destination drive, which is the SSD. Make sure to double-check and confirm that you have selected the correct drives.

Step 5:Configure clone hard drive to ssd free

Configure the Cloning Settings Once you have selected the source and destination drives, you can configure the cloning settings. Some of the settings you can adjust include the partition size, cloning method, and sector-by-sector cloning. Make sure to read the instructions carefully and choose the settings that suit your needs.

Step 6:Start the Cloning Process

Start the Cloning Process After configuring the cloning settings, click on the “Start” button to begin the cloning process. The duration of the cloning process depends on the size of the hard drive and the cloning software you are using. During the cloning process, make sure not to turn off your computer or interrupt the process.

Step 7: Verify the Cloning Process

Verify the Cloning Process Once the cloning process is complete, you should verify that the cloned SSD works correctly. Remove the original hard drive from your computer and replace it with the cloned SSD. Boot up your computer and make sure that all your data, files, and applications are present and working correctly. You can also check the SSD’s performance and speed by running benchmark tests.

How do I know if my computer is compatible with an SSD?

To use an SSD as your main storage device clone hard drive to ssd free, your computer must have a compatible SATA or NVMe interface, as well as an available drive bay or M.2 slot. You can check your computer’s specifications or consult with the manufacturer to determine if it is compatible with an SSD upgrade.

What software can I use to clone my hard drive to an SSD for free?

There are several free software options available for cloning a hard drive to an SSD, including EaseUS Todo Backup Free, Macrium Reflect Free, and Clonezilla. Each of these programs offers step-by-step instructions for cloning your hard drive to an SSD.
